GTM(Google Tag Manager)是一种标签管理工具,可以帮助网站管理员在不修改代码的情况下管理和部署各种跟踪代码和标签。而SPA(Single Page Application)是一种现代化的Web应用程序架构,它在加载页面时只会更新部分内容,而不是整个页面的刷新。
要在Google Analytics中获取SPA的页面计时,可以通过以下步骤使用GTM实现:
- 创建Google Analytics标签:登录到GTM后台,创建一个新的标签,选择Google Analytics作为标签类型。填写Google Analytics跟踪ID,并选择相应的跟踪类型(例如页面浏览)。
- 配置触发器:在标签配置中,选择触发器选项卡,并创建一个新的触发器。根据SPA的特性,选择自定义事件触发器,并设置事件名称为页面计时开始的事件。
- 配置变量:在标签配置中,选择变量选项卡,并创建一个新的变量。根据SPA的特性,选择JavaScript变量,并设置变量名称为页面计时开始的变量。在变量的JavaScript代码中,使用适当的方法(例如performance.timing)来获取页面计时的开始时间。
- 部署标签:保存并发布GTM容器,将生成的GTM代码部署到SPA的页面中。确保将GTM代码放置在页面的头部或尽可能靠近页面的顶部。
通过以上步骤,当SPA的页面加载时,GTM会捕获页面计时开始的事件,并将其发送到Google Analytics进行跟踪和分析。你可以在Google Analytics中查看页面计时的数据,并根据需要进行进一步的分析和优化。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云云服务器(CVM):提供可扩展的云服务器实例,适用于各种应用场景。产品介绍链接
- 腾讯云云原生应用引擎(TKE):提供全托管的Kubernetes服务,简化容器化应用的部署和管理。产品介绍链接
- 腾讯云对象存储(COS):提供高可靠性、低成本的对象存储服务,适用于海量数据的存储和访问。产品介绍链接
- 腾讯云区块链服务(BCS):提供一站式的区块链解决方案,帮助企业快速搭建和管理区块链网络。产品介绍链接
- 腾讯云人工智能(AI):提供丰富的人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。产品介绍链接